tigergirl Posted June 26, 2006 Posted June 26, 2006 Hi all, I haven't ever used FMPs web interface before, so forgive me if this is a ridiculously easy task that I'm asking help with. What I'd like to to do is set up a web questionnaire that our customers can access. Ideally, I would create a customer record in our office computer, then send them a web link to the questionnaire form for their record. I would only want them to be able to view and fill in their record, not view or change any other records, obviously. I assume that information then would be transmitted automatically to our computer's database. Is this possible? If so, would we need to leave our office computer on all the time with FMP open? Thanks, as always, for your help!
Genx Posted June 26, 2006 Posted June 26, 2006 Ummm, i would suggest getting them to fill in the questionaire using global fields - and then submitting these when they have completed your questionaire. And yes FMP would always have to be open with the appropriate ports forwarded through your firewall and with IWP turned on. Hope this helped ~Genx
